Exegesis

The demonstrative elu {אלו | ʾē-lû} precedes the indirect object elav {אֵלָיו֙ | ʾê-lā-yōw} ‘to him,’ sharpening Saul’s address.

In context1 Samuel 22:13

And Saul said to him, “Why have you conspired against me, you and the son of Jesse, by giving him bread and a sword and by inquiring of God for him, so that he rises up against me to lie in ambush as on this very day?”
